Cisco has launched the Borderless Profithon partner programme aimed at accelerating Borderless Networks business in the SMB and mid-market segment for routing, switching, security and wireless technologies.
It is designed to reward partners, and to drive awareness for Cisco's Borderless Networks Architecture across SMB markets. The programme will remain live until April 29, 2011.
All Cisco partner organizations providing this portfolio will get an opportunity to win numerous attractive rewards. The company plans to undertake a 30-city roadshow to educate customers, on the benefits of Borderless Networks architecture and partners, on ways to derive greater profits from the borderless networks portfolio.
